Salem is the capital of the U.S. territory of Oregon and the district seat of Marion County.
It is situated in the focal point of the Willamette Valley close by the Willamette River which
runs north through the city. The waterway shapes the limit amongst Marion and Polk
areas and the city neighborhood of West Salem is in Polk County. Salem was established
in 1842 turned into the capital of the Oregon Territory in 1851 and was consolidated in
1857.
Salem had a populace of 154637 at the 2010 statistics making it the third biggest city in
the state after Portland and Eugene. Salem is somewhat more than a hour pushing
separation far from Portland. Salem is the essential city of the Salem Metropolitan
Statistical Area a metropolitan region that spreads Marion and Polk provinces and had a
joined populace of 390738 at the 2010 enumeration. A 2013 gauge put the metropolitan
populace at 400408 the states second biggest.
The city is home to Willamette University Corban University and Chemeketa Community
College. The State of Oregon is the biggest open manager in the city and Salem Health is
the biggest private boss. Transportation incorporates open travel from Salem-Keizer
slide 2: Transit Amtrak benefit the transport benefit Cherriots and non-business air go at McNary
Field. Real streets incorporate Interstate 5 Oregon Route 99E and Oregon Route 22
which interfaces West Salem over the Willamette River by means of the Marion Street and
Center Street spans.
HISTORY: The Native Americans who inhabited the central Willamette Valley at first
European contact the Kalapuya called the area Chim-i-ki-ti which means "meeting or
resting place" in the Central Kalapuya language Santiam. When the Methodist Mission
moved to the area they called the new establishment Chemeketa although it was more
widely known as the Mill because of its situation on Mill Creek. When the Oregon Institute
was established the community became known as the Institute.
When the Institute was dissolved the trustees decided to lay out a townsite on the Institute
lands.Some possible sources for the name "Salem" include William H. Willson who in
1850 and 1851 filed the plats for the main part of the city and suggested adopting an
Anglicized version of the Biblical word "Shalom" meaning peace. The Reverend David
Leslie President of the towns Trustees also wanted a Biblical name and suggested
using the last five letters of "Jerusalem".Or the town may be named after Salem
Massachusetts where Leslie was educated. There were many names suggested and
even after the change to Salem some people such as Asahel Bush editor of the Oregon
Statesman believed the name should be changed back to Chemeketa.The Vern Miller
Civic Center which houses the city offices and library has a public space dedicated as the
Peace Plaza in recognition of the names by which the city has been known.

DEOGRAPHY AND CLIMATE: Salem is situated in the north-focal
Willamette Valley in Marion and Polk areas. The 45th Parallel generally the midpoint
between the North Pole and the Equator goes through Salems city limits.
As indicated by the United States Census Bureau the city has an aggregate region of
48.45 square miles 125.48 km2 of which 47.90 square miles 124.06 km2 is arrive and
0.55 square miles 1.42 km2 is water.
